Class C shares are a class of mutual fund share characterized by a level load that includes annual charges for fund marketing, distribution, and servicing, set at a fixed percentage. These fees amount to a commission for the firm or individual helping the investor decide on which fund to own. WebOct 20, 2024 · 3. Level Load (Class C Shares) Like B shares, these don’t have an up-front fee either. However, Class C shares do carry the highest ongoing expenses of the three classes.
